What Kind of Buyer Are You? (And Why It Actually Matters)

Shanna Schmidt  |  October 27, 2025

I'm noticing a trend lately - there are three primary buyer types in today's real estate market.

Some people bring spreadsheets. Some bring their dog to showings (I LOVE when this happens, but no - your dog may not tour the home). Some show up with zero expectations and simply trust the universe will give them a sign. We've seen it all, and we've learned that the smoothest, smartest home purchases happen when we understand your style, and you understand our process.

I'll break it down for you. Here are, from my perspective, the three primary buyer personalities we run into most often, and how we can work together to make your life easier, your search smarter, and your stress level reasonable.

First, we have The Analyst.
Loves: Spreadsheets, market reports, statistics, and interest rate charts dating back to 1991
Struggles with: Pulling the trigger
Favorite phrase: "Let me sleep on it for a night...or two."

Analysts are thinkers. They're planners. They've researched for months, possibly years before coming to us. They know the average price per square foot in five different neighborhoods (but maybe not how little that actually matters in most instances). They can recite the last three Fed announcements. They've probably even run the numbers on what each potential home would rent for during a recession.

Honestly, we love analysts! They're thorough and grounded in facts. Unfortunately, no spreadsheet can account for what it FEELS like to live in a home. At some point, the data won't give you permission to proceed. You have to trust your gut - and your team.

We can help by respecting the numbers and brining our own. You'll get data that actually matters, backed by real-world experience. Our job is to help you spot the line between smart research and sneaky avoidance. We are not here to rush you, but rather to keep it real.

Then we have The Romantic.
Loves: Charm, light, "good vibes", daydreaming
Struggles with: Budget, boundaries, and reality
Favorite Phrase: "I KNOW this is the one" (often before they've even seen it in person)

Romantics buy with their heart. They walk into a house and start picturing Birthday parties and first days of school. They fall in love with original tile, get emotional about natural light, and they don't really care about resale value as long as it "feels" right.

We get it! Buying a home IS emotional. However, skipping inspection because the backyard "feels sacred" isn't a plan - it is a liability.

We can help you romantics without killing your vibe. We ask the hard questions, check the crawl space, and make sure your dream house doesn't come with nightmare plumbing. You dream big and we'll keep the foundation solid (literally). We typically become fast friends with our romantics.

Finally, we have the uncertain explorer.
Loves: Nothing yet. They just want someone to tell them what to do.
Struggles with: Decision fatigue, Zillow spiral, and sometimes crying at every decision point
Favorite Phrase: "I don't even know what I want anymore."

The overwhelmed buyer didn't start this way. Somehow, between rising interest rates, conflicting advice, and ten thousand home listings, they hit a wall. Now everything feels like too much for them.

If you fall into this category, you are far from alone. This is a lot! Especially if you're relocating, going through a major life change, or trying to perfectly time a sale and a purchase at the same time.

We can help by taking the lead and letting you breathe. We ask the right questions (the ones you didn't even know to consider), help you get clear on your goals, and narrow your options so you're not flailing in a sea of listings. You don't have to have it all figured out because that is, literally, our job.

Soooo...which one are you?

You might be one, or a mix of two, or something entirely different - we are not here to box anyone in. We are here to help move you forward with clarity, confidence, and a team that knows how to meet you where you are.

In case you're wondering if now is a good time to buy in the Denver Metro area - it is!!

Inventory is abundant, which means you actually have options (novel concept, right?). Prices have softened and sellers are negotiating - not only on price, but also on terms, inspection items, and even closing costs. Interest rates are hovering under 6%, which is a gift compared to where we were not all that long ago.

Now is your window of opportunity, giving you leverage, choice, and the ability to make a move that aligns with your goals (not just your FOMO).
